Comprehensive Guide to Door Repairs: Understanding the Process, Costs, and TechniquesDoors are essential elements of every home and business, supplying security, personal privacy, and visual appeals. Nevertheless, wear and tear can result in various problems, requiring door repairs. This short article checks out typical door issues, repair methods, associated costs, and often asked concerns about door repairs. Types of Door RepairsDoors can suffer from a series of problems depending on their type, product, and use. A few of the most typical kinds of door repairs include:

  1. Hinge Repairs:
    • Loose hinges causing doors to sag.
    • Rusty hinges that need replacement or lubrication.
  2. Door Frames:
    • Damaged or distorted frames from weather exposure.
    • Fractures or divides in the frame.
  3. Locks and Latches:
    • Broken locks that require replacement.
    • Misaligned latches preventing appropriate closure.
  4. Surface area Damage:
    • Scratches, dents, and holes in wood or metal doors.
    • Faded paint or surface needing repainting or refinishing.
  5. Weather condition Stripping:
    • Worn out or harmed weather condition removing permitting drafts or wetness.

Step-by-Step Guide to Common Door RepairsBelow are numerous common door repair techniques, outlining steps and needed products.Repairing a Sagging DoorA sagging door can be an annoyance, typically triggered by loose hinges or a distorted frame.Products Needed:

  • Screwdriver
  • Wood shim
  • Level

Steps:

  1. Check Hinge Screws: Inspect the hinge screws for tightness. If they are loose, tighten them utilizing a screwdriver.
  2. Utilize a Level: Place a level versus the door to see how far it is sagging.
  3. Insert Shims: If the door is sagging significantly, place a wood shim behind the top hinge. This can help raise the door back into place.
  4. Re-tighten Screws: After adjusting the shim, re-tighten the hinge screws. Evaluate the door and make more modifications if required.

Repairing a Sticky DoorA sticky door can be brought on by humidity, temperature level modifications, or misalignment.Materials Needed:

  • Sandpaper or a hand plane
  • Screwdriver

Steps:

  1. Inspect for Rubbing: Close the door and check which areas are rubbing against the frame.
  2. Remove Door if Necessary: If significant change is needed, get rid of the door using a screwdriver.
  3. Sand the Rubbing Areas: Use sandpaper or a hand airplane to shave down the areas that are sticking. Be patient and test often.
  4. Rehang and Adjust: Rehang the door and make any last changes.

Changing a Door LockA malfunctioning lock can posture security threats and trouble.Products Needed:

  • New lock set
  • Screwdriver
  • Determining tape

Steps:

  1. Remove the Old Lock: Unscrew the existing lockset from both the interior and outside sides of the door.
  2. Measure and Prepare: Measure the door’s thickness and the existing holes to make sure a proper fit for the new lock.
  3. Set Up the New Lock: Follow the maker’s guidelines to set up the brand-new lock, guaranteeing it’s properly lined up and safely fastened.
  4. Check the Lock: Test the lock to ensure it operates efficiently.

Repainting or Refinishing a DoorDoors can start to look worn gradually, needing a fresh coat of paint or stain.Materials Needed:

  • Paint or stain
  • Primer (if painting)
  • Paintbrush or roller
  • Sandpaper
  • Tidy cloth

Actions:

  1. Remove Hardware: Take off doorknobs and other hardware to make painting easier.
  2. Sand the Surface: Lightly sand the door to remove old paint or stain and develop a smooth surface for adhesion.
  3. Clean the Door: Wipe the door with a tidy cloth to get rid of dust and debris.
  4. Apply Primer: If painting, apply a coat of guide.
  5. Paint or Stain: Apply the picked paint or stain with even strokes, permitting each coat to dry thoroughly before adding extra coats.

Cost Involved in Door RepairsThe expense of door repairs can vary significantly based on the type of repair required and your geographical area. Below is a general introduction of anticipated costs:Repair TypeApproximated Cost RangeHinge repairs₤ 10 – ₤ 50Frame repair₤ 50 – ₤ 200Lock replacement₤ 30 – ₤ 150Surface area refinishing₤ 50 – ₤ 300Weather removing₤ 10 – ₤ 50Keep in mind: The expenses might exclude any possible labor charges if employing an expert.Often Asked Questions About Door Repairs1.
